Primary Duties and Responsibilities
- Providing excellent service to residents, guests, employees and contractors.
- Completing all routine service requests within 24 hours at the direction of Maintenance Supervisor.
- Ensuring the clean condition of the community at all times.
- Maintaining the maintenance shop according to policy.
- Reporting maintenance issues to the Maintenance Supervisor and Community Manager for review.
- Assisting in other tasks as directed by the Maintenance Supervisor.
Minimum Qualifications
- A high school graduate or GED certificate and experience in apartment maintenance preferred.
- Ability to read, write, speak, and communicate in English.
- Ability to work weekends or overtime as job requires.
Certificates, Licenses, Registrations
- EPA Certification preferred, Universal preferred
- City and/or State certification requirements must be met if applicable (i.e. pool operations, maintenance, electricians, etc.)
- Certified Apartment Maintenance Technician (CAMT) preferred

Working Conditions
- Work is performed in an indoor and outdoor field environment; travel from site to site; exposure to dust, grease, noise, fumes, noxious odors, gases, mechanical and electrical hazards, and all types of weather and temperature conditions.
- Primary functions require sufficient physical ability and mobility to walk, stand, and sit for prolonged periods of time; to frequently stoop, bend, kneel, crouch, crawl, climb, reach, twist, grasp, and make repetitive hand movement in the performance of daily duties; to climb unusual heights on ladders; to lift, carry, push, and/or pull moderate to heavy amounts of weight; to operate assigned equipment and vehicles; and to verbally communicate to exchange information.
- Primary functions may require working long hours and odd schedules (weekends) in order to fulfill job duties.
